A painting is 16 inches wide. it is placed inside a frame with a border that is x inches wide. The total width of the painting a

nd the frame is 20 inches. Create an equation to model the situation, then solve the equation to find the width of the border.
Mathematics
1 answer:
zloy xaker [14]3 years ago
4 0
16 + 2x = 20
2x = 20 - 16 = 4
x = 4/2 = 2 inches

Solve the equation for x<br><br> 5(x-3)+2x=4(x+3)
Tamiku [17]

x = 9

Step-by-step explanation:

5x - 15 + 2x = 4x + 12

7x - 4x = 12 + 15

3x = 27

x = 9
